Online & Distance Learning at Temple University
Many students take online classes at Temple University. Of 29,640 students, 2,344 (8%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 12,742 (43%) took at least some classes online.

Other Marketing Master’s Program at Temple University
Of the 14 master’s other marketing degrees awarded at Temple University, 100% were women (14) and 0% were men (0).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Other Marketing master’s degree recipients at Temple University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 7 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 4 |
| Asian | 1 |
| Unknown | 2 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 36% of Other Marketing master’s degree recipients at Temple University, lower than the national average of 47%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
